Programme fairs/memorabilia

Featured Replies

While looking into a wardrobe for somesuch the other day,I came across some old Chelsea programmes that kinda brought a tear to my eye.

Not because I'm the nostalgic type mind,but mostly because I dropped the fecking box on my big toe!.

There inside, were all Chelsea's domestic cup final programmes from the late 60's & early 70's which I'd brought from programme fairs nearly 30 years ago.Fantastic stuff to be honest with you.

I haven't been to one since then & my only memory's are of dark,squat halls with a strong musty smell of old paper, (or maybe it was from the old boys flogging the programmes) & a place where the only women present, were the type of girl who can crush a walnut with her chin.

Question is.....does anyone else remember them?.......do they still exsist in this age of ebay?.....& does anyone else have programmes/memorabilia that they brought from one?.

I'm pretty sure these fairs still exist. Saying that the last one I went to was about 5 years ago at Pompey in a darkened hall with a musty smell/ I seem to recall my mate saying it was an annual thing and he's spoken since then about going again.

My dad-inlaw & a mate both deal in progs ect, fairs are still going strong, there's one at St Stephens church hall Kensington, 1st sunday of every month, also there's two big fairs, one in June near Russel Sq & the other in Jan not far from Holbon.

Got every home programme from 1963 to 1969,every home and away from 1969 to 1986,then every home up to 1999 when i gave up collecting,most of the older ones up to 1974 was passed down to me by my uncle and then i started collecting myself as i was going to most games.Only programme fair i have been too was the one in russell sq that Cb mentioned last year and i think i had more chelsea programmes than they did.My collection also includes every testimonial and friendly and cup games,some are worth two bob others are worth a bit more like the chelsea leeds cup final replay goes for about £20,and if anyone has the greek version of the cup winners cup 1971 v real madrid that goes for up to £500 maybe more,sadly i only have the chelsea version of it and its only worth about £30.Still my pride and joy though and will probably pass them on to my boy,if he can find the room for them

Chelsea Independent was a great fanzine, I missed Issue No.1 but got them all after that, Red Card was OK, not quite as serious.

I had When Saturday Comes from the first issue and then there was another really good early 'zine from the Midlands which I can't remember the name of (Off the Ball?), I think the editor has become an established journo. I used to go to Sportspages and come out with loads from different clubs, I must have had first issues from many of them as new ones appeared every week.
